BOULDER, Colo. — At some point in fall 2018, Bo Gribbon started to vomit and couldn’t cease. He threw up a number of instances an hour from morning to nighttime earlier than his mom drove him to the hospital close to their residence right here.

“It felt like Edwards Scissorhands was making an attempt to seize my intestines and pull them out,” mentioned Gribbon, then 17.

Over the subsequent 9 months, Gribbon went to the emergency room 11 instances for a similar drawback: extreme vomiting and screaming on the identical time that lasted for hours. When a doctor’s assistant instructed him the seemingly trigger, Gribbon didn’t imagine it at first. He had by no means heard of marijuana producing a facet impact like that.

Bo Gribbon, 20, went to the ER 11 instances in 9 months for a situation that precipitated bouts of nonstop vomiting and screaming. Medical professionals instructed him it was from continual hashish use however he did not imagine it till stopping hashish lastly made the vomiting cease.Robin Noble

“The one factor that satisfied me was that it stopped after I stopped smoking,” mentioned Gribbon, now 20.

Colorado and Washington grew to become the primary states to legalize leisure marijuana in 2012. A number of years later, medical doctors in Colorado and different states are expressing alarm over the growing efficiency of hashish and the well being dangers it might pose for younger customers — from psychiatric points, together with violent psychotic episodes, to the mysterious situation that plagued Gribbon.

The situation — formally known as “cannabinoid hyperemesis syndrome” however now recognized to well being care staff as “scromiting,” a mashup of “screaming” and “vomiting” — has popped up with growing frequency at hospitals in Colorado, medical doctors say.

The ER at Parkview Medical Heart in Pueblo noticed solely 5 scromiting circumstances in 2009. By 2018, the quantity had risen to greater than 120, in line with knowledge compiled by Dr. Brad Roberts, an emergency room doctor on the hospital.

Reviews of the syndrome doubled in two completely different ERs within the state shortly after legalization, in line with one study.

Roberts mentioned the presence of those sufferers strains hospital sources. When confronted with folks affected by bouts of nonstop vomiting, medical doctors usually order up an array of diagnostic exams to rule out different underlying causes.

“We burn up quite a lot of medical sources to see if there may be something extra significantly fallacious with them,” Roberts mentioned.

A 2018 national research review known as the syndrome “an more and more prevalent and sophisticated drawback for well being care suppliers and sufferers.”

Hashish has been consumed by people for hundreds of years, however comparatively little is understood about cannabinoid hyperemesis syndrome.

The situation was first reported in scientific literature in 2004. The accessible analysis since then signifies that it stems from continual use of particularly highly effective marijuana.

A 2017 review of studies discovered that 97 p.c of people that developed the situation reported utilizing marijuana at the least as soon as per week. About 75 p.c mentioned they consumed hashish commonly for over a yr.

“These sufferers usually bear costly medical testing, might require hospital admission for symptom administration, and infrequently expertise vital delays in analysis,” the authors wrote.

The authors famous that it’s not but recognized why some marijuana customers develop cannabinoid hyperemesis syndrome and others don’t. The truth that marijuana is utilized by many individuals to suppress nausea provides to the thriller.

Individuals who’ve had the syndrome say it may be alleviated with sizzling showers or baths, however the episodes usually proceed till the affected person stops utilizing marijuana altogether.

Scromiting circumstances have elevated as pot has turn into way more highly effective, in line with medical doctors. Specialists say the marijuana consumed 20 years in the past had ranges of THC, the primary psychoactive ingredient, of two p.c to three p.c, however hashish merchandise now bought in markets like Colorado can have THC ranges as excessive as 90 p.c.

Dr. Timothy Meyers, the chair of the emergency division at Boulder Group Well being, mentioned when he first arrived on the hospital 18 years in the past, it was a situation he by no means noticed.

“Now I see it virtually day by day,” he mentioned.

Psychiatric issues

4 Colorado medical doctors interviewed by NBC Information mentioned they’ve additionally seen a rise within the variety of sufferers with psychiatric points after consuming highly effective marijuana. A 2019 study discovered that consuming hashish with THC ranges exceeding 10 p.c elevated the percentages of a psychotic episode.

“Virtually day by day I see a affected person within the ER who’s having a psychotic break after taking high-potency THC,” Roberts mentioned.

Dr. Karen Randall labored in emergency rooms in Detroit for 19 years however she mentioned she by no means noticed something just like the acute violent psychotic reactions from excessive efficiency THC hashish that she is seeing now in her emergency room in Pueblo, Colo.Dr. Karen Randall

Dr. Karen Randall, who works within the Parkview Medical Heart emergency room with Roberts, mentioned she spent 19 years working in a downtown Detroit emergency room, however that didn’t put together her for what she characterised because the excessive quantity of “acutely violent psychotic sufferers” in Colorado.

“I by no means noticed something like this,” Randall mentioned.

Marijuana has lengthy been thought-about a nonaddictive drug that causes few, if any, critical uncomfortable side effects. It’s nonetheless not clear if it causes extra critical psychological well being issues, however a growing body of research suggests it may have damaging results on adolescent brains.

An growing share of Colorado’s $2 billion hashish market is made up of concentrates or different merchandise with excessive ranges of THC, in line with Tim Ruybal Jr., who based Dyspense, an organization that tracks stock for the trade. Ruybal mentioned concentrates made up 43 p.c of the market share in 2020, up from 32 p.c in 2019.

“Proof for the way hashish, particularly in greater concentrations, impacts psychological well being is rising and stronger, particularly on the way it pertains to psychosis and schizophrenia-like signs,” mentioned Dr. G. Sam Wang, an emergency room physician and toxicologist at Youngsters’s Hospital Colorado in Denver.

“These impacts are seen extra with higher-concentrated merchandise and with extra frequent use,” Wang mentioned.

Lawmakers take action

Randall and Roberts have been amongst a gaggle of Colorado medical doctors who threw their assist behind a state invoice designed to shut a loophole that allowed younger folks between the ages of 18 and 20 to get their fingers on massive portions of high-potency pot.

Hashish is just not authorized in Colorado for folks underneath 21, however previous to the invoice’s passage in late Might, 18-year-olds might get state medical playing cards after a short name with a physician, permitting them to purchase as much as 400 doses per day procuring from retailer to retailer.

The brand new laws requires these underneath 21 to go to two separate medical doctors in particular person to get a medical marijuana card and limits the quantity they’ll purchase from a person retailer. It additionally restricts the quantity of marijuana concentrates that individuals over 21 should buy at medical dispensaries and mandates the creation of a monitoring system to stop folks from going store to buy to amass massive portions of pot.

Individuals stand in freshly painted circles, six-feet-apart, as they wait in a two-hour line to purchase marijuana merchandise from Good Chemistry on March 23, 2020 in Denver.Michael Ciaglo / Getty Photos file

Rep. Judy Amabile, a state lawmaker who represents Boulder, supported the invoice and gave an impassioned speech on the Home ground linking her personal son’s expertise with schizophrenia to hashish.

“In every single place he went, this product was accessible and in larger and larger concentrations and efficiency,” she mentioned.

“It’s too late for him,” she added. “Let’s speak as a substitute about your youngsters.”

In an interview with NBC Information, Amabile mentioned she was shocked the invoice handed with such extensive margins.

“To me that may be a sea change, and I credit score this group of activist mothers who testified, who actually put within the work to teach legislators,” she mentioned.

‘My life was falling apart’

The invoice is directed at younger folks like Will Brown, 17.

Brown instructed NBC Information his mom would typically discover him on his bed room ground unable to talk after he inhaled concentrated hashish oil vapors in a course of known as dabbing.

“I knew I could not cease,” Brown mentioned. “My life was falling aside round me.”

Jasmine Block, 18, mentioned she bought high-potency hashish from sellers who obtained medical playing cards fraudulently.

“They needed to revenue off of those youthful youngsters, who do not have entry to this,” she mentioned.

“I’m an advocate for stricter marijuana insurance policies and stricter doctor-to-patient relationships and the {qualifications} it’s good to meet with a purpose to get a medical marijuana card,” Block mentioned. “As a result of [from] expertise, it’s so straightforward to get your fingers on.”

Each Block and Brown are actually sober and attend 5280 High School, a Denver constitution college for teenagers with substance points. They mentioned they’re alarmed to fulfill youngsters of their restoration teams who dabbed in center college.

“It is form of terrifying to simply watch,” Brown mentioned.

Colorado’s hashish trade supported the brand new laws. Truman Bradley, govt director of the Marijuana Business Group, mentioned the commerce affiliation believes younger folks “ought to by no means use hashish until underneath the strict supervision of a medical skilled.”

Truman Bradley is the Government Director of Colorado’s Marijuana Business Group (MIG) that in the end supported new laws designed to cut back the quantity of excessive efficiency hashish somebody should purchase in Colorado.NBC Information

“MIG has labored with a broad base of Colorado stakeholders for over a decade to offer younger folks with proof based mostly info with a purpose to make good choices,” he added.

However Bradley mentioned he doesn’t see the necessity for added regulation on marijuana efficiency.

“I suppose I do not see the correlation between a efficiency change and youngsters illegally consuming hashish,” Bradley mentioned. “It should not occur, whether or not it is 60 p.c, 50 p.c, 40 p.c. The problem is how is it getting there? And I really feel like we took a serious step to get there.”

He mentioned eliminating sure merchandise altogether would encourage the black market. “Youngsters are going to do what youngsters are going to do,” he mentioned.

Bo Gribbon is now sober and headed to school this fall to check digital music.

He mentioned he’s clear-eyed that what occurred to him was a results of his personal choices, however he mentioned the trade must also be held accountable.

“I don’t know if anybody must go to jail, however I feel they must be sued,” he mentioned.

Gribbon’s mom, Robin Noble, mentioned pot may go for some folks, however “for my son, it stole his curiosity and curiosity in life.”

Now that he has stopped, she mentioned, “his basic pleasure is again.”
